Nicky Burkett is finally out of jail. However, his problems are only just beginning, particularly when a dead Member of Parliament is found in the communal stairway outside his flat. This is the story of a race against time, which ends in a violent denouement on the posh slopes of Wengen.

Jeremy Cameron has worked in the field of crime for thirty years; the last ten of them as a probation officer in Walthamstow. He also lives in Walthamstow and tries to make sure no one tries to steal his car by driving a Skoda.
